What is the best time to visit Chirala?

The best time to visit Chirala, a beautiful coastal town in Andhra Pradesh, India, is during the winter months, specifically from October to March. During this period, the weather is pleasant and ideal for enjoying the beaches and exploring the local attractions. The temperature ranges from a comfortable 20°C to 30°C, making it perfect for outdoor activities. Avoid visiting during the summer months (April to June) as the heat can be intense and humid. The monsoon season (July to September) brings heavy rainfall, which might disrupt your travel plans. Planning your trip during the winter ensures a more enjoyable and comfortable experience, allowing you to fully appreciate the scenic beauty and cultural richness of Chirala.

How can you reach Chirala?

Reaching Chirala is relatively straightforward, with multiple transportation options available. Here's a detailed breakdown of how you can get to Chirala:

ModeDetails
By TrainChirala has its own railway station (CLX), which is well-connected to major cities in Andhra Pradesh and other parts of India. Regular trains from cities like Vijayawada, Guntur, and Chennai stop at Chirala. This is often the most convenient and economical way to reach the town.
By RoadChirala is accessible by road, with well-maintained highways connecting it to nearby cities and towns. You can take a bus from Vijayawada, Guntur, or Ongole. Several private and state-run bus services operate on these routes. Alternatively, you can hire a taxi or drive yourself.
By AirThe nearest airport to Chirala is Vijayawada International Airport (VGA), which is approximately 110 km away. From the airport, you can hire a taxi or take a bus to reach Chirala. Vijayawada Airport is well-connected to major cities like Hyderabad, Chennai, and Bangalore.

Choosing the best mode of transport depends on your budget, time constraints, and personal preferences. Trains and buses are generally more affordable, while flying offers the quickest option, followed by a road trip to Chirala.

What are popular nearby destinations to visit from Chirala?

Chirala serves as a great base for exploring other interesting destinations in Andhra Pradesh. Here are some popular nearby places you can visit:

DestinationDistance (approx.)Highlights
Vijayawada110 kmKanaka Durga Temple, Undavalli Caves, Prakasam Barrage.
Guntur70 kmAmaravati Archaeological Museum, Kondaveedu Fort, Mangalagiri.
Ongole40 kmKothapatnam Beach, Chennakesava Swamy Temple.

These nearby destinations offer a diverse range of experiences, from historical sites and religious places to scenic landscapes, enhancing your overall travel experience in Andhra Pradesh.

Are there any specific festivals celebrated in Chirala?

Yes, Chirala, being a part of Andhra Pradesh, celebrates several festivals with great enthusiasm. Some of the prominent festivals include:

  • Sankranti: A major harvest festival celebrated in January, marked by colorful decorations, kite flying, and special dishes.
  • Ugadi: The Telugu New Year, celebrated with traditional rituals, special foods, and cultural performances.
  • Vinayaka Chavithi: Celebrated in honor of Lord Ganesha, with elaborate decorations, prayers, and processions.
  • Dasara: A ten-day festival celebrating the victory of Goddess Durga over the demon Mahishasura, marked by special prayers, cultural events, and processions.
  • Diwali: The festival of lights, celebrated with fireworks, lighting lamps, and exchanging sweets.

Attending these festivals provides a unique opportunity to experience the local culture and traditions of Chirala and Andhra Pradesh.

What is the local language spoken in Chirala?

The local language spoken in Chirala is Telugu. It is the primary language of communication for the majority of the population in Chirala and the broader Andhra Pradesh region. While Hindi and English are understood by some, especially in tourist areas, knowing a few basic Telugu phrases can be very helpful in interacting with locals and enhancing your travel experience. Learning simple greetings and polite expressions in Telugu can show respect for the local culture and make your interactions more pleasant.

Are there any ATMs or banks available in Chirala?

Yes, Chirala has several ATMs and bank branches to facilitate financial transactions for both locals and tourists. You can find ATMs of major banks like State Bank of India, Andhra Bank, and ICICI Bank in the main town area. It's advisable to carry some cash along with your cards, as smaller establishments and local markets might not accept card payments. Banks usually operate during standard business hours, so plan your visits accordingly. Having access to banking services ensures convenience and ease of managing your finances during your stay in Chirala.
